After breakfast, depart for Tarangire National Park via Arusha town. You may stop for any last-minute purchases before heading to the park. The drive along the Northern Highway crosses the Masai Steppe and local villages, taking about 2 to 3 hours. Upon arrival, start your game drive in Tarangire, the fifth largest national park in Tanzania, known for its large elephant population and majestic baobab trees. Expect to see herds of elephants, wildebeest, giraffes, zebras, warthogs, hippos, and the rare species of Greater Kudu, Fringed-eared Oryx, and Ashy Starling. Bird watchers will delight in over 400 species of birds. Predators such as lions, hyenas, cheetahs, jackals, and leopards also roam the park. After an exhilarating day, head to your lodge for dinner and overnight stay.
